I worked on that a bit. There were 3 space stations built, 2 at Sony Studios. 1 was a regular set and then a matching station on a gimble so that we could put the actors on "zip lines" to whizz through the corridors simulating weightlessness (wires will be erased in post production).
The third was built at a cold storage facility so that we could see the actors breath. They kept dropping the temp so the vapor would show up better, eventually hitting 25 degrees. This was when we were going through a heatwave, must have been 110 that week, thought I was going to catch pneumonia going from extreme cold to heat all day long.
